Prof. Dr. Mohamed Hemida Abd-Alla is currently working as Professor at Botany Department, faculty of Science, Assiut University, Egypt. He has completed his Ph.D. in Botany from same University. Previously he was appointed as Demonstrator, Assistant Lecturer, Lecturer and Associate Professor at Assiut University, Egypt. He also served as Visiting Professor at Institute of Plant Nutrition, Justeus Liebig University, Giessen, Germany, Makerere University, Kampala, Uganda, and Niigata University, Niigata, Japan. Dr. Mohamed Hemida received honors includes the best Scientific research in the faculty of Science awarded by the Assiut University, Prof. Dr. Sluman Hozen for best scientific research in Biology awarded by the faculty of Science, Abdus Salam Prize in the field of Biology awarded by united Nations Educational, Scientific and Cultural Organization, and Scientific Award of Excellence from American Biographic Institute (USA). He is member of editorial board in journals such as Research Journal of Microbiology, Research Journal of Soil Biology, and Current Research in Bacteriology, Asian Journal of Plant Pathology, and Bacteriology Journal. He is serving as referee for journals such as World Journal of Microbiology and Biotechnology, International Journal of hydrogen Energy, Applied Energy, Journal of Plant Breeding and Crop Science, Maejo International Journal of Science and Technology, Thailand J. Agric. Science, Journal of Arab Association of Universities of Basic and Applied Sciences (JAAUBAS), New Zealand Journal of Agriculture and Horticulture, Fuel and Energy Journal and Fuel Journal. He successfully supervised 10 Masters and 5 PhD students in the field of Symbiotic Nitrogen fixing Bacteria and Pathogenic Bacteria. His area of research interest focuses on Molecular Signals of Nitrogen fixing Symbiotic Bacteria and Phytopathogenic Bacteria, Apoplastic and Symplastic transport of Root Nodule Bacteria, Biofuel Production, Bioremediation, and Biofertilizers. He has 83 publications in journals contributed as author/co-author.
